Series 5 Episode 11
"School's Out"
Guest Starring: Lloyd Daniels
“Helen, I demand answers!”, James Lester shouted. Helen Cutter had kidnapped him, Claudia Brown and Jess Parker as part of her massive master plan-type thing. Helen clicked her fingers, and two soldiers brought the Minister in. He was dirty and looked rather ragged.
“We’ve placed people in positions of power. The team are helpless. There are only a few members left now”, Helen explained.
“What, people have died?”, Claudia asked. She was concerned for the team, as they were like her second family.
“No-one is dead yet. Danny, Lloyd, Sarah and Harriet are locked up. The rest will be dealt with”
Danny and Lloyd tried to budge open the classroom door. They had been sent to a fake anomaly site, and now they were trapped. Sarah and Harry were out cold still.
“I’ll phone Cutter”, Lloyd decided. He went to his pocket, but his phone had gone. Danny searched for his, but it had gone aswell.
“Right, whoever trapped us in here clearly doesn’t want us escaping”, Danny stated.
“Well done”, Lloyd replied, sarcastically.
“What about the windows? If we can get them open, we could get out”, suggested Danny.
“It’s worth a shot. Just count ourselves lucky we’re not on the first floor”
They wandered over to the other side of the room, but the windows were locked. The boys raided the teacher’s desk drawers, but there were no keys for either the windows or the doors. They sat down, exhausted and out of ideas.
“Hang on! Does Sarah have an Anomaly Opener?”, Lloyd thought.
“Possibly. I’ll check her bag”, Danny decided. He felt a bit rude doing so, as a gentleman should never go through a woman’s bag, but desperate times call for desperate measures.
“Found it!”, Danny grinned, “Now how do you work it?”
Cutter had rapidly finished the meeting with the headteacher. As far as he was concerned, the team were more important, and he knew Danny was in trouble. Was it a creature? Regardless, he and the others followed the (fake) anomaly signal on the Detectors.
Bleep bleep. Bleep bleep. Bleep bleep.
They strolled through the corridors, admiring the displays on their way through.
Bleep bleep. Bleep bleep. Bleep bleep.
“Ah, I see Nick’s trying to rescue Danny. Isn’t that lovely”, Helen noticed. She had hacked into the ARC systems, and was viewing exactly what Jess would be seeing.
The signal cut off. Cutter and the team were lost. They had no idea where Danny was, and couldn’t help him. The phone kept ringing and had no answer.
“I think we need to split up”, Cutter decided.
“No, something fishy is going on. We need to stay together”, Jenny suggested.
“She has a point”, Connor added.
“OK then. But we need to be quick. Danny could be in serious danger”, Cutter agreed.
Danny and Lloyd were fiddling around with the Opener. In all fairness, it wasn’t hard to operate. Danny finally pressed the button, and there was an anomaly.
“Right, we need to get one to the ARC”, Lloyd mentioned. The new style Opener was able to accept addresses, so they put in the address of the ARC.
DING DING! DING DING! DING DING!
An alarm (not the Detector) went off in Helen’s base. The anomaly was interfering.
“Oh, they think they can get away that easily?”, Helen smirked.
The fire bell rang, and children were evacuated out of the school. Little did the headteacher know, and Cutter for that matter, that the original anomaly signal was fake…
Cutter’s team’s Detectors started beeping again, and they followed the sound. The only difference this time - they ran.
The anomaly was right there in the classroom, all ready to go.
”Ready?”, Danny smiled. He picked up Sarah, and Lloyd picked up Harry, and they carried them through the anomaly….just as Cutter and the others reached the classroom. They walked up to the anomaly, but before they could go through, it closed.
Danny and the rest of them didn’t see Cutter, but things went from bad to worse as they found themselves in the Late Cretaceous era, but of course neither Danny nor Lloyd knew that.
“This isn’t the ARC”, Lloyd stated the obvious. The anomaly automatically closed behind them.
“Well, let’s get out of here”, Danny said, but when he held up the Opener, it had died. They had no way back, and no way out.
Helen had diverted the signal, and had drained the power from the Opener. She had everyone out of her way, and now her mission was to get to Cutter.
“Nick - he created the future world. I’ve never been more sure of it. And I know that it’s my duty to sort this out”, Helen spoke. Claudia, Lester and Jess were extremely worried.
